I bought this cast aluminum flywheel to be on the safe side to remove the governor on my new predator 212 "I've heard the stock flywheels are unsafe at high RPM's" and this new flywheel is a legit upgrade. I have not used the 8 degree advance timing key yet "I just used the stock one that came with the motor for now" but I did receive it, along with another stock timing key. The motor does spool up faster on acceleration and I'm not worried about the flywheel coming apart when running the motor wide open with no governor. I did lap the new flywheel in with valve grinding compound as suggested by youtubes "BLACK 66" He has a great channel I highly suggest checking him out... I have also upgraded to GoPowerSports 18LB valve springs to prevent valve float as i'm using the stock cam with no governor. So the flywheel, 18LB valve springs, and Governor delete are the only things i have done to my new engine so far and it runs great for what I want my mini bike to do right now "Pretty Freekin Fast!" I would recommend all the products I have used on this motor... MINI BIKES ARE AWESOME!

After carefully lapping in the fly wheel and checking with engineer blue I cleaned the mating surfaces and installed the flywheel using the supplied 7 degree key .Upon starting the engine it was back firing like crazy.Removed flywheel to find that the offset timing key had basically disintegrated itto metal flakes which I could crumble with my fingers. I went through the lapping processagain and installed a new standard OEM key the engine then it ran ok . I was lucky that the crankshaft on my engine was not damaged . Its running but I still need a key that will give me the correct advanceThe main reason I selected this seller was because I needed the advanced key .I have used several of this type of flywheel in the past the first two worked great and still work fine .The last two I have been problematic I won't be buying more !

Works fine but doesn't have enough timing advance. I don't bother with the included #8 key. I time them to 32 degrees and torque them down without a key.
